VAC Automation Technician

3 months ago


Houston, Texas, United States Bray Architects Full time

Lead automation assembly for the newly formed Valve Automation Center (VAC). Effectively assemble, build, commission, troubleshoot and repair Bray automated valve packages. Maintain on time build schedules for new shop-built valve automation assemblies, maintaining a consistency of build quality and workmanship throughout. Manage inventory of accessories, fittings and tubing needed to integrate automated assemblies, while working closely with the operations and engineering team to seamlessly execute and continuously improve processes. Record testing and documentation, and complete systematic transactions. Work effectively with VAC Value Stream Manager, Buyer/Planner, Project Engineer, and other assembly teams. Essential Job Functions and Responsibilities:

Assemble, test, commission, troubleshoot and repair entire range of Bray valve & automation products as well as buyout products. Work will primarily be performed in house with the possibility field service calls at customers' facilities. Perform all work required to complete assemblies and repairs of Bray automated valve assemblies in time sensitive and diverse situations. Complete all production transactions and documentation in a timely manner. Work closely with the Valve Automation Center Team and other assembly personnel to seamlessly execute jobs. Communicate daily with back-office personnel. Understand and follow all operational and safety procedures. Perform on site customer training for all Bray products. Attend all company meetings as requested. Record work stoppages and escalate to various departments for timely resolution: Quality Control, Engineering, Planning, Machine Shop, etc. Maintain clean organized shop area, per 5S principles. Responsible for consumables inventory control, identification/submittal of purchase request of parts needed for replenishment.

Qualifications and Core Competencies:

  • 5+ years' experience in valve and automation manufacturing industry, with direct experience working with pneumatic and electric automation and controls.
  • High School degree or equivalent.
  • Strong mechanical and technical aptitude.
  • Ability to troubleshoot, test, repair, and service technical equipment.
  • Understanding of elect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ic schematics and wiring diagrams.
  • Excellent communication and good customer service skills.
  • Strong ability to work well with various members of the team as well as other teams.
  • Basic working knowledge of MS Office applications and other related software.
  • Experience with ERP systems is a plus.
  • Detail orientated, information seeking, willingness to learn, enjoy fast paced team environment.
  • Ability to work under pressure, self-driven, proactive, and systematic in approach.
  • Time management and punctual.
Performance Standards:
  • Overarching goals for department pertain to Shipment volume, On Time Delivery, and Delivery Time.
  • Customer complaints and assembly work stoppages are also tied to this position's effectiveness.
  • Successful execution of responsibilities in relation to automated assemblies, timely and organized management of orders, tools and inventory.
  • Effective communication and seamless coordination of tasks and process with operations, engineering and project teams.
  • Excellent customer service and promptness in response to internal and external requests.
  • Clean and organized work area, records and inventory.
  • High standard of quality and testing, with thorough documentation.
